精品欧美一区二区三区在线观看 _久久久久国色av免费观看性色_国产精品久久在线观看_亚洲第一综合网站_91精品又粗又猛又爽_小泽玛利亚一区二区免费_91亚洲精品国偷拍自产在线观看 _久久精品视频在线播放_美女精品久久久_欧美日韩国产成人在线

互聯網大廠有哪些分庫分表的思路和技巧?

運維 數據庫運維
作者個人研發的在高并發場景下,提供的簡單、穩定、可擴展的延遲消息隊列框架,具有精準的定時任務和延遲隊列處理功能。

作者個人研發的在高并發場景下,提供的簡單、穩定、可擴展的延遲消息隊列框架,具有精準的定時任務和延遲隊列處理功能。自開源半年多以來,已成功為十幾家中小型企業提供了精準定時調度方案,經受住了生產環境的考驗。為使更多童鞋受益,現給出開源框架地址:https://github.com/sunshinelyz/mykit-delay

寫在前面

注:本文已收錄到:https://github.com/sunshinelyz/technology-binghe 和 https://gitee.com/binghe001/technology-binghe

分庫分表

分庫分表是隨著業務的不斷發展,單庫單表無法承載整體的數據存儲時,采取的一種將整體數據分散存儲到不同服務器上的不同數據庫中的不同數據表的存儲方案。分庫分表能夠有效的緩解數據的存儲壓力,分庫分表是數據存儲達到一定規模時必然會遇到的問題。掌握分庫分表的思路和技巧有助于小伙伴們更好的解決實際工作中,有關數據拆分的問題。

接下來,我們就分別對分表和分庫來談談一些使用的思路和技巧。

分表

分表,最直白的意思,就是將一個表結構分為多個表,然后,可以在同一個庫里,也可以放到不同的庫。當然,首先要知道什么情況下,才需要分表。個人覺得單表記錄條數達到百萬到千萬級別時就要使用分表了。

分表的分類

1.縱向分表

將本來可以在同一個表的內容,人為劃分為多個表。(所謂的本來,是指按照關系型數據庫的第三范式要求,是應該在同一個表的。)

分表技巧: 根據數據的活躍度進行分離,(因為不同活躍的數據,處理方式是不同的)

案例:

對于一個博客系統,文章標題,作者,分類,創建時間等,是變化頻率慢,查詢次數多,而且最好有很好的實時性的數據,我們把它叫做冷數據。而博客的瀏覽量,回復數等,類似的統計信息,或者別的變化頻率比較高的數據,我們把它叫做活躍數據。所以,在進行數據庫結構設計的時候,就應該考慮分表,首先是縱向分表的處理。

這樣縱向分表后:

(1)首先,存儲引擎的使用不同,冷數據使用MyIsam 可以有更好的查詢數據。活躍數據,可以使用Innodb ,可以有更好的更新速度。

(2)其次,對冷數據進行更多的從庫配置,因為更多的操作是查詢,這樣來加快查詢速度。對熱數據,可以相對有更多的主庫的橫向分表處理。

其實,對于一些特殊的活躍數據,也可以考慮使用memcache ,redis之類的緩存,等累計到一定量再去更新數據庫。或者mongodb 一類的nosql 數據庫,這里只是舉例,就先不說這個。

2.橫向分表

字面意思,就可以看出來,是把大的表結構,橫向切割為同樣結構的不同表,如,用戶信息表,user_1,user_2 等。表結構是完全一樣,但是,根據某些特定的規則來劃分的表,如根據用戶ID來取模劃分。

分表技巧: 根據數據量的規模來劃分,保證單表的容量不會太大,從而來保證單表的查詢等處理能力。

案例:

同上面的例子,博客系統。當博客的量達到很大的時候,就應該采取橫向分割來降低每個單表的壓力,來提升性能。例如博客的冷數據表,假如分為100個表,當同時有100萬個用戶在瀏覽時,如果是單表的話,會進行100萬次請求,而現在分表后,就可能是每個表進行1萬個數據的請求(因為,不可能絕對的平均,只是假設),這樣壓力就降低了很多。

注意:數據庫的復制能解決訪問問題,并不能解決大規模的并發寫入問題,要解決這個問題就要考慮MySQL數據切分了。

數據切分

顧名思義,就是數據分散,將一臺主機上的數據分攤到多臺,減輕單臺主機的負載壓力,有兩種切分方式,一種是分庫,即按照業務模塊分多個庫,每個庫中的表不一樣,還有一種就是分表,按照一定的業務規則或者邏輯將數據拆分到不同的主機上,每個主機上的表是一樣的,這個有點類似于Oracle的表分區。

分區

分庫又叫垂直分區,這種方式實現起來比較簡單,重要的是對業務要細化,分庫時候要想清楚各個模塊業務之間的交互情況,避免將來寫程序時出現過多的跨庫讀寫操作。

分表又叫水平分區,這種方式實現起來就比垂直分區復雜些,但是它能解決垂直分區所不能解決的問題,即單張表的訪問及寫入很頻繁,這時候就可以根據一定的業務規則(PS:如互聯網BBS論壇的會員等級概念,根據會員等級來分表)來分表,這樣就能減輕單表壓力,并且還能解決各個模塊的之間的頻繁交互問題。

分庫的優點是: 實現簡單,庫與庫之間界限分明,便于維護,缺點是不利于頻繁跨庫操作,不能解決單表數據量大的問題。

分表的優點是: 能解決分庫的不足點,但是缺點卻恰恰是分庫的優點,分表實現起來比較復雜,特別是分表規則的劃分,程序的編寫,以及后期的數據庫拆分移植維護。

實際應用

實際應用中,一般互聯網企業的路線都是先分庫再分表,兩者結合使用,取長補短,這樣發揮了MySQL擴展的最大優勢,但是缺點是架構很大,很復雜,應用程序的編寫也比較復雜。

以上是MySQL的數據切分的一些概念,數據切完了,現在要做的是怎么樣在整合起來以便于外界訪問,因為程序訪問的入口永遠只有一個,現在比較常用的解決方案是通過中間代理層來統一管控所有數據源。例如,可以使用冰河深度參與開發的Mycat中間件,也可以使用亮總開源的ShardingSphere中間件。

本文轉載自微信公眾號「冰河技術」,可以通過以下二維碼關注。轉載本文請聯系冰河技術公眾號。

 

責任編輯:武曉燕 來源: 冰河技術
相關推薦

2021-10-29 07:25:32

分庫分表技巧

2021-12-16 10:32:04

APP會員互聯網大廠用戶

2022-01-05 16:45:22

互聯網裁員危機

2022-08-31 16:17:21

造芯互聯網公司大廠

2022-06-01 20:24:25

互聯網元宇宙大廠

2021-12-14 15:27:48

互聯網程序員裁員

2020-02-23 17:39:21

互聯網復工公司

2020-07-19 10:06:02

互聯網數據技術

2022-02-24 11:05:06

互聯網加班科技

2020-03-05 13:55:50

MySQL分庫分表數據庫

2019-10-25 15:50:06

MySQL數據庫命令

2018-08-23 09:06:18

互聯網百度面試

2021-11-22 10:03:47

互聯網薪資技術

2023-05-02 22:38:46

JVMJVM調優

2023-02-07 09:01:30

字符串類型MySQL

2023-12-11 14:20:00

系統緩存本地緩存

2019-12-11 15:45:49

互聯網數據技術

2022-01-24 10:46:40

互聯網裁員

2021-06-28 08:57:29

快手騰訊員工

2019-12-09 16:09:00

互聯網
點贊
收藏

51CTO技術棧公眾號

欧美重口乱码一区二区| 久久久久久欧美| 国产小视频精品| 91ph在线| 国产精品1区二区.| 久久久久国产一区二区三区| 中文字幕一区二区久久人妻网站| 成人黄色免费短视频| 亚洲人123区| 精品亚洲欧美日韩| 一区二区三区免费观看视频| 亚洲午夜av| 亚洲日韩欧美视频| 在线观看免费看片| 最新欧美色图| 樱花影视一区二区| 欧美精品一区二区三区四区五区| 夜夜躁狠狠躁日日躁av| 99精品热视频只有精品10| 中文字幕精品一区二区精品| www.555国产精品免费| 国产一区二区三区朝在线观看| 亚洲特黄一级片| 久久久久九九九| 99在线观看免费| 亚洲大胆视频| 久久综合五月天| 老熟妇一区二区| 2020国产精品极品色在线观看| 欧美午夜在线观看| 九九爱精品视频| av一本在线| 99re热这里只有精品免费视频| 成人欧美一区二区三区在线湿哒哒| av大片免费在线观看| 我不卡神马影院| 亚洲色在线视频| 星空大象在线观看免费播放| www欧美在线观看| 一本久久精品一区二区| 女人帮男人橹视频播放| 在线观看的网站你懂的| 中文字幕二三区不卡| 欧美激情第一页在线观看| 丰满大乳国产精品| 国产一区二区按摩在线观看| 国产欧美精品一区二区| 免费看日批视频| 99在线|亚洲一区二区| 欧美激情亚洲另类| 外国一级黄色片| 亚洲九九视频| 久久精品成人欧美大片| 天天色天天综合| 久久在线电影| 日韩资源在线观看| 91大神福利视频| 久久香蕉国产| 久久精品国产一区| 国精产品一区一区二区三区mba| 波多野结衣在线观看一区二区三区| 日韩精品亚洲元码| 波多野结衣一本| 亚洲天堂日韩在线| 亚洲色图狂野欧美| 亚洲一二三精品| 99久久婷婷| 久久精品视频导航| 爱爱视频免费在线观看| 午夜国产精品视频| 欧美激情一级欧美精品| 日本少妇全体裸体洗澡| 亚洲欧美日韩国产一区二区| 欧美一级免费看| 精品久久久久久久久久久久久久久久| 石原莉奈在线亚洲二区| 国产精品天天狠天天看| 亚洲在线免费观看视频| 国产一区二区不卡| 国产一区再线| 国产中文字幕在线播放| 中文字幕免费不卡在线| 99re99热| 福利成人导航| 色综合色狠狠天天综合色| 国产精品视频分类| 欧美片网站免费| 亚洲精品999| 日韩毛片无码永久免费看| 久久亚洲专区| 久久久日本电影| 精品国产乱子伦| 国产一区二区三区四区在线观看| 国产欧美一区二区视频| 毛片在线能看| 自拍视频在线观看一区二区| 亚洲 欧美 综合 另类 中字| 综合毛片免费视频| 欧美剧情电影在线观看完整版免费励志电影| 一区二区三区国产好的精华液| 51亚洲精品| 国产亚洲精品高潮| 久草资源在线视频| 日韩国产欧美在线观看| 粉嫩精品一区二区三区在线观看| 免费a在线观看| 亚洲女人小视频在线观看| 男女超爽视频免费播放| 国内自拍亚洲| 欧美精品一区男女天堂| 女人黄色一级片| 亚洲第一黄色| 成人激情在线观看| 国产资源在线观看| 亚洲成人av中文| 日韩va在线观看| 九九视频免费观看视频精品| 欧美国产极速在线| 在线播放精品视频| 99久久伊人精品| 看一级黄色录像| 日韩欧美精品一区二区综合视频| 欧美成人乱码一区二区三区| 成年人看的免费视频| 国产日韩欧美一区在线| 99热国产免费| 成人video亚洲精品| 色婷婷综合激情| 九九久久久久久| 久久美女视频| 国产激情综合五月久久| 天堂网在线观看视频| 亚洲精品一二三四区| 中文字幕亚洲乱码| 精品久久久久中文字幕小说| 午夜精品一区二区三区在线视 | 五月天激情播播| 色棕色天天综合网| 57pao国产成人免费| 高清乱码毛片入口| 亚洲自拍偷拍综合| aaaaa黄色片| 亚洲精品午夜av福利久久蜜桃| 国产精品久久久久久久久粉嫩av | 2022中文字幕| 成人自拍视频| 久久精品亚洲一区| 91在线观看喷潮| 国产精品久久久久久久久久久免费看 | 欧美第一精品| 国产欧美一区二区三区久久| 国产福利在线| 欧美日韩中文字幕一区| 亚洲午夜久久久久久久国产| 视频一区在线播放| 日韩精品最新在线观看| 91国内外精品自在线播放| 亚洲欧美日韩精品久久亚洲区| 国产毛片aaa| 91在线视频观看| 男人日女人bb视频| 欧美人妖在线| 国产精品无码专区在线观看| 在线国产91| 在线不卡a资源高清| 亚洲AV成人无码精电影在线| 国产一区二区三区免费在线观看| 韩国黄色一级大片| 大奶在线精品| 人妖精品videosex性欧美| 黄色电影免费在线看| 在线观看国产一区二区| 最新日韩免费视频| 国产精品乡下勾搭老头1| 男女激情免费视频| 亚洲亚洲免费| 成人网中文字幕| 牛牛电影国产一区二区| 亚洲精品在线观看www| 国产第一页在线观看| 国产精品久久久久久久久晋中| 午夜一区二区视频| 一区在线视频观看| 欧美午夜视频在线| 成人免费观看49www在线观看| 色综合色综合久久综合频道88| 日本黄色不卡视频| 在线观看日产精品| 538精品在线观看| 337p粉嫩大胆噜噜噜噜噜91av| 污片在线免费看| 欧美黄色一区| 欧美午夜欧美| 日韩在线视频一区二区三区 | 国产午夜福利一区二区| 久久久久久久久蜜桃| 亚洲色图偷拍视频| 一本久久知道综合久久| 亚洲乱码国产乱码精品天美传媒| 麻豆精品国产| 日韩av免费网站| av网址在线| 亚洲欧美中文日韩在线v日本| 国产精品自拍电影| 色呦呦日韩精品| 青娱乐国产在线视频| 久久精品视频一区二区| 欧美一区二区三区影院| 日本v片在线高清不卡在线观看| 国产乱人伦精品一区二区三区| 久久91麻豆精品一区| 高清视频一区| av在线亚洲一区| 国产成一区二区| 美女av在线免费看| 萌白酱国产一区二区| 国产一二三区在线视频| 亚洲大胆人体av| 精品人妻av一区二区三区| 91福利视频在线| 久久午夜免费视频| 亚洲一区二区三区在线| 999精品视频在线观看播放| 久久亚区不卡日本| 蜜臀av粉嫩av懂色av| 国产在线播放一区| 亚洲三级视频网站| 性一交一乱一区二区洋洋av| 97干在线视频| 午夜视频一区| 国产免费xxx| 婷婷综合亚洲| 中文字幕欧美日韩一区二区三区| 国产一区二区三区不卡视频网站| 国精产品99永久一区一区| 欧美久久一区二区三区| 91精品啪aⅴ在线观看国产| 69堂免费精品视频在线播放| 欧美整片在线观看| 三级在线看中文字幕完整版| 欧美精品福利视频| 欧洲在线视频| 欧美激情成人在线视频| 亚洲性图自拍| 欧美成人剧情片在线观看| 国产区在线看| 久久视频在线观看免费| 黄网站在线播放| 久久久国产视频91| av网站网址在线观看| 久久久精品在线观看| 理论片午午伦夜理片在线播放| 少妇高潮久久77777| 日本视频在线免费观看| 色婷婷综合久久久久| 看黄网站在线| 欧美精品在线第一页| 狂野欧美性猛交xxxxx视频| 欧美高清视频在线| caoprom在线| 日本亚洲欧美成人| 成人毛片免费| 亚洲最大av在线| 粉嫩av一区二区| 乱一区二区三区在线播放| 蜜乳av综合| 一区二区视频在线观看| 亚洲二区三区不卡| 六月婷婷激情综合| 在线视频免费在线观看一区二区| 虎白女粉嫩尤物福利视频| 日韩电影在线免费| 亚洲精品国产久| 成人av在线看| 人妻aⅴ无码一区二区三区| 中文子幕无线码一区tr| a在线视频播放观看免费观看| 一区二区三区成人在线视频| 欧美一二三区视频| 91成人在线免费观看| 97人妻精品一区二区三区软件| 日韩欧美国产小视频| 深夜福利免费在线观看| 综合国产在线视频| 久久大胆人体| 国产成人一区二区在线| 国产美女视频一区二区| 美女主播视频一区| 欧美顶级大胆免费视频| 可以看毛片的网址| 秋霞午夜av一区二区三区| 精产国品一区二区三区| 久久免费看少妇高潮| 日韩三级久久久| 天天综合天天做天天综合| 中文字幕免费视频观看| 欧美电影免费提供在线观看| 你懂的好爽在线观看| 久久最新资源网| 激情都市亚洲| 99久热re在线精品996热视频| 国产精品免费不| 一级性生活视频| 日韩国产欧美在线观看| 色婷婷精品久久二区二区密| 中文在线免费一区三区高中清不卡| 久久成人在线观看| 欧美在线观看一区| 色综合久久久久久| 久久艳片www.17c.com| 巨茎人妖videos另类| 成人高清在线观看| 97精品一区二区| 欧美少妇性生活视频| 成人免费视频网站在线观看| 免费成人美女女在线观看| 日韩欧美成人免费视频| 国产 日韩 欧美 综合| 日韩中文理论片| 欧美××××黑人××性爽| 国产乱码精品一区二区三区卡| 国产精品久久久久久| 国产激情在线观看视频| 99国产欧美另类久久久精品| 永久看片925tv| 678五月天丁香亚洲综合网| aiai在线| 日韩美女视频中文字幕| 欧美男男freegayvideosroom| 国产免费内射又粗又爽密桃视频| 麻豆精品一区二区| 人人妻人人澡人人爽| 一本大道综合伊人精品热热| 欧美熟妇另类久久久久久不卡| 久久成年人免费电影| 成人日韩视频| 久久精品国产精品亚洲精品色| 轻轻草成人在线| 91在线无精精品白丝| 欧美中文字幕一二三区视频| 九九在线视频| 日韩av成人在线| 免费视频亚洲| 国产一区二区视频免费在线观看| 99热99精品| 国产黄色片免费看| 精品亚洲一区二区三区在线观看| aa国产成人| 精品视频一区二区三区四区| 亚洲精品在线二区| 女人被狂躁c到高潮| 第一福利永久视频精品| 三级理论午夜在线观看| 欧美亚洲成人网| 伊人久久综合影院| 久久精品午夜福利| 亚洲国产精品激情在线观看 | 日韩精品乱码免费| 91麻豆精品国产91久久综合| 91九色02白丝porn| 色影院视频在线| 亚洲伊人第一页| 精品电影一区| 国产又爽又黄无码无遮挡在线观看 | 热舞福利精品大尺度视频| 水蜜桃久久夜色精品一区的特点| av网在线播放| 欧美日韩成人在线| 91在线中文| 激情视频一区二区| 日日夜夜一区二区| 久久国产高清视频| 精品国产制服丝袜高跟| 日本在线播放不卡| 蜜桃一区二区三区在线| 日本 欧美 国产| 日韩精品在线网站| 九色porny丨国产首页在线| 日韩福利视频| 国产在线观看一区二区| 伊人久久综合视频| 国产亚洲综合久久| 日韩精品一区二区三区中文字幕| 免费毛片网站在线观看| 亚洲国产精华液网站w| 国产suv一区二区| 5566成人精品视频免费| 清纯唯美亚洲综合一区| 国产不卡的av| 黑丝美女久久久| 免费大片黄在线观看视频网站| julia一区二区中文久久94| 性高湖久久久久久久久| 三级影片在线观看| 亚洲黄色av女优在线观看| 看片一区二区| www一区二区www免费| 18成人在线观看| 欧美性孕妇孕交| yellow视频在线观看一区二区|